Alozie is currently with the Super Falcons at the ninth edition of the FIFA Women’s World Cup, FIFAWWC, co-hosted by New Zealand and Australia.
The talented defender was in action from start to finish as the Super Falcons held Olympic champions Canada to a credible goalless affair in their opening game of the competition.
She put up an above-average performance. Making four clearances, one interception, and winning five ground dwells.
Alozie also won five tackles and had 50 touches en route helping Nigeria Super Eagles to a clean sheet from a position at right-back.
